GenericAccessRights 列挙型
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
Windows 2000 および Windows NT のアクセス形式を使用して、メッセージ キューによって、読み取り、書き込み、および実行のための標準アクセス権とオブジェクト固有のアクセス権の両方に割り当てられる、共通アクセス権のセットを指定します。
この列挙体は、メンバー値のビットごとの組み合わせをサポートしています。
public enum class GenericAccessRights
[System.Flags]
public enum GenericAccessRights
[<System.Flags>]
type GenericAccessRights =
Public Enum GenericAccessRights
- 継承
- 属性
フィールド
All | 268435456 | 読み取りアクセス、書き込みアクセス、および実行アクセス。 |
Execute | 536870912 | アクセスを実行します。 |
None | 0 | アクセスできません。 |
Read | -2147483648 | 読み取りアクセス。 |
Write | 1073741824 | 書き込みアクセス。 |
注釈
GenericAccessRights列挙では指定できる内容の詳細は少なくなりますが、通常は、対応するすべての標準権限と特定の権限を指定するよりも簡単です。 各オブジェクトの種類は、標準 (ほとんどの種類のセキュリティ保護可能なオブジェクトに共通) とオブジェクト固有の権限のセットに汎用アクセス権をマップできます。
たとえば、ユーザーにメッセージ キューへの読み取りおよび書き込みアクセス権を付与すると、キューからのメッセージの送受信が可能になります。 ただし、アクセス権の制御を細かくするには、 と MessageQueueAccessRights 列挙を使用StandardAccessRightsして、ユーザーがメッセージをピークできるが受信できない、キューまたはメッセージを削除できる、キューのプロパティを設定できるなどの指定を行うことができます。
適用対象
こちらもご覧ください
.NET